L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 741|回复: 5

内核升级的问题

[复制链接]
发表于 2004-6-14 19:13:39 | 显示全部楼层 |阅读模式
按照2.4升2.6的方法,我试着升级但在安装RPM包mkinitrd-3.5.15.1-2.i386.rpm出现了问题了:
error: Failed dependencies:
        lvm2 is needed by mkinitrd-3.5.15.1-2
说需要LVM2的包,可我LVM2的包已经安装完了呀!!!这是为什么呢!?
这是我安装LVM2包时候显示的相关信息
[root@biglong longlei]# rpm -ivh lvm2-2.00.08-2.i386.rpm
warning: lvm2-2.00.08-2.i386.rpm: V3 DSA signature: NOKEY, key ID 9d6b4012
Preparing...                ########################################### [100%]
        file /usr/share/man/man8/lvchange.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vcreate.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vdisplay.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vextend.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vm.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vmchange.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vmdiskscan.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vreduce.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vremove.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vrename.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/lvscan.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/pvchange.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/pvcreate.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/pvdisplay.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/pvmove.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/pvscan.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gcfgbackup.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gcfgrestore.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gchange.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gck.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gcreate.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gdisplay.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gexport.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gextend.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gimport.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gmerge.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gmknodes.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greduce.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gremove.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grename.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gscan.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12
        file /usr/share/man/man8/vgsplit.8.gz from install of lvm2-2.00.08-2 conflicts with file from package lvm-1.0.3-12



大家知道这是为什么吗!~?鞠躬了!
另外我想问一下,这几个包都是什么呀,有什么作用呢!?module-init-tools-3.0 当然,这个我也想问问是干什么的!
发表于 2004-6-14 19:25:10 | 显示全部楼层
你的lvm2没装上。
提示和lvm1有冲突,试试用rpm -Uvh lvm2-2.00.08-2.i386.rpm 来安装
发表于 2004-6-14 19:57:17 | 显示全部楼层
lvm2和lvm1这是两个不同的包,用rpm -U不行吧。
发表于 2004-6-14 20:19:52 | 显示全部楼层
看不明
 楼主| 发表于 2004-6-15 13:19:35 | 显示全部楼层
同意二楼所说的,LVM1和LVM2不是相同的包,所以不能够用参数U,说没装上,可我用rpm qa |grep lvm查找,可是找不到这个包的说呀,系统告诉我说这个包没有安装,这是为什么呢!?
发表于 2004-6-15 14:06:42 | 显示全部楼层
你试试 rpm -ivh --replacefiles lvm2-2.00.08-2.i386.rpm 我一开始也是向你说的那样,后来用了这个命令之后,就全都ok了!
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表